mastravel:

Your skilled work experience must be in the same type of job (have the same NOC) as the job you want to use for your immigration application (called your primary occupation)

• Must be within the last 10 years.
• Paid work (have been paid wages or earned commission. (volunteer work or unpaid internships don’t count)
• At least 1 year of continuous work or 1,560 hours total (30 hours per week)—you can meet this in a few different ways:
Part-time or full-time.

grandlexuz:


Hello I only just now saw your post which was done over two weeks ago; quite late because you didn't hit my mention.. Have you left Nigeria already? Did you get a new passport.? As a student you should be able to get a two years residential permit for half the regular price.

Nigerians pay roughly 200 dollars for a two years permit. As a student it could cost you about 90 dollars. I will advice you get one as soon as you arrive. Cameroonians are required to be in possession of a national identity card at all times and by law the non possession of an ID card when required by an officer could land you six months in prison

Although Nigerians don't need a visa to visit Cameroon you are required a passport to enter which gets an entry stamp. That enables you to travel to your destination without the hassle of the police. I'm not saying you can't get through without a passport but be ready to pay bribes to never friendly money hungry police officers as you journey through. Mind you from the border to your destination you will encounter a thousand of them.

Ope4Christ:


It depends on what purpose and country you are doing authentication for. But you need the following documents to be authenticated:

1. SSCE original, it is compulsory(plus N1200 WAEC card for verification).
2. BSc, MSc, PhD, ND, HND certificate.(any one that is applicable to you).
3. Eligibility letter, you will apply for it (N1000).

But if for the purpose of study, you will add:

4. Original transcript of records.
5. Three sets of photocopies of each document are required. If you are going to study abroad you will do additional sets of photocopies for admission because two from the three sets stated above are are going to be retained in the two ministries (MOE and MFA).

It is one step after the other. You will start with MOE (it takes 2 to 3 days depending on population) while MOF takes one day but you must be there by 9am. They close by 1pm and will not allow you in again. They don't do authentication on Fridays o.

Authentication cost N300 per page multiplied by the total number of pages you want to do. Plus some extra charges for application form (N450), remitars - for individual payments at the two ministries etc.

You can add Voters Card or Drivers Licence to your NIMC print out for identification. But if you don't have any of them you better wait for your passport to be out because they will send you back to your destination.
